Dysrupt is looking for an Associate Director, Account Management of Paid Social, who’s ready to take the next leap in their performance marketing career. You’ll bring strategic rigor to a portfolio of clients, shape paid media campaigns from brief to execution, and act as a trusted advisor across platforms. You’re excited by innovation, energized by solving business problems with media, and equally skilled at hands‑on campaign management and big‑picture thinking.

Responsibilities
  • Own Campaign Execution:
    Build, launch, and optimize campaigns across key biddable platforms (Meta, Google, Tik Tok, etc.) with flawless precision and full accountability for performance.
  • Lead Platform Strategy:
    Develop paid media plans and tactical approaches rooted in client goals, industry benchmarks, and historical insights.
  • Drive Operational Excellence:
    Champion internal processes, campaign QA, pacing checks, and reporting frameworks to ensure seamless delivery across all clients.
  • Deliver Performance Insights:
    Analyze campaign data, uncover trends, and package insights into compelling stories that drive client trust and decision‑making.
  • Collaborate Cross‑functionally:
    Partner closely with Client Leads, Creative, and Analytics to ensure your strategies ladder up to broader campaign goals.
  • Support Innovation & Testing:
    Own test design and execution within your book of business, helping move both client performance and agency capabilities forward.
  • Contribute to Culture:
    Share knowledge, platform updates, and POVs across the team to keep Dysrupt’s media offering sharp, fast, and future‑focused.
Qualifications
  • 5-6 years of performance marketing experience managing paid social and digital media campaigns, especially across Meta, Google, Tik Tok, Snapchat, and You Tube.
  • Expert‑level knowledge of paid media campaign structures, pacing, optimization levers, and critical metric alignment.
  • Deep comfort with large datasets, ad tech tools, and reporting platforms like Google Data Studio (Looker Studio).
  • Clear and confident communicator — able to explain strategies and insights to clients and internal partners alike.
  • Proven track record of running complex campaigns independently with speed, accuracy, and performance results.
  • A proactive perspective; you identify issues early and take initiative to solve them.
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to juggle multiple accounts and priorities.
Nice to Have
  • Certifications from Meta, Google, or other key platforms
  • Experience with creative performance analysis or working closely with creative teams
  • Familiarity with MMM, incrementality testing, or third‑party measurement tools
